Output 52878255e33a1de1ad364d6b6f004d901b52860ad26129823d6e2a50e15dafa7:0

value
1648223
script pubkey
OP_0 OP_PUSHBYTES_20 629b88fcd20d5e83453bf388cb1b9fa2f82fda2e
address
bc1qv2dc3lxjp40gx3fm7wyvkxul5tuzlk3w7gctes
transaction
52878255e33a1de1ad364d6b6f004d901b52860ad26129823d6e2a50e15dafa7
spent
true